Constant Contact Employees Love To Go To work. ...
  • 13 years ago
"We all work hard, and at the end of the day, we love working with each other." See for yourself why Constant Contact employees use words like "fun,” "fast-paced,” and “collaborative” to describe their jobs.
Recommended